• Environment; TE's global infrastructure server, storage, backup/recovery, and cloud (SSBRC) function supporting 40,000+ TE users in 50+ countries utilizing 1,000+ applications. SSBRC supports global infrastructure located across multiple datacenters, remote offices, and cloud service providers. The platform services delivered support the building blocks used by all of TE's application services. Our cloud platforms have an emphasis on high reliability & availability, cost optimization & efficiency, security, as well as ease of use to emanate high levels of confidence in running essential services.



Business Unit Description TEIS GISS
Position Overview: This position is responsible for both the architectural as well as operational support of TE's global cloud footprint using multiple cloud service providers leveraging a mix of IaaS, PaaS, and CSP specific native services. This position is responsible for the strategic planning, implementation, governance, and standardization of cloud offerings and services within the TEIS/GISS infrastructure. Key objectives of this role include driving strategy, planning and delivery of platforms, maintaining and updating TE's cloud governance & guiderails, as well as optimizing TE's hybrid cloud (multi-cloud and "on-premise") architecture and solutions, thereby improving the stability of our systems, and speed to deliver new systems.

Responsibilities & Qualifications
Responsibilities:

• Delivers strategy and roadmap development in alignment with infrastructure teams to ensure effectiveness of our IT infrastructure and systems.
• Responsible for all aspects of cloud budget including planning, forecasting, adherence and reporting at multiple levels. This includes developing a strong understanding of workload utilization and the application footprint that is being supported by TE's cloud platforms
• Manages a team of engineers specific to cloud technologies. Via that team, ensures the on-going operational support and continuity of platform services delivered in the cloud (backup and recovery, IAM roles & policies, compute/storage/networking service delivery, CSPM management and follow-ups, security edge configuration, account / subscription management, cost allocation, etc.)
• Cross trains on-prem teams in a hybrid environment to drive our cloud journey, as well as finds opportunities to educate the cloud engineers on our "on-premise" architecture and synergies (critical awareness in a hybrid environment)
• Drives innovation, research, and selection of technologies to support or enhance our cloud platforms.
• Acts as a strong liaison with the TEIS SRM (Security & Risk Management) team, providing insight and collaboration to ensure our cloud footprint security posture stays up to date
• Remains current with cloud technologies and offerings in order to align business goals with cloud capabilities. Promotes continuous training and advocacy communication with our technical account teams
• Proactive and ongoing vendor management to ensure SLA/OLA expectations as well as KPI metrics.
• Aligns cloud solutions with on-prem technologies to leverage common tool sets when applicable. Collaborates with on-prem teams on larger strategy/vision.
• Provides project consulting and oversight, in collaboration with the SSBRC solutions team and other application and security solution architects
• Drives cost efficiencies across TEIS GIS as they relate to cloud platforms and cloud solutions including, but not limited to, enterprise agreements, private pricing agreements, reserved/committed compute discounts, right-sizing, automated lifecycle & cleanup, as well as cloud vendor incentives for workload migrations, in a concerted effort to control costs.
• Ensures projects are delivered on time and within budget.
• Responsible for ensuring all cloud documentation and enterprise-wide reference material (cloud governance and framework) is maintained and updated as required, including any KB articles, research/position papers, and Confluence sites
• Responsible for team reviews, goal setting and performance reviews.
• Responsible for all platform related contracts through collaboration with Procurement and Contract Management teams
• Provides training and mentorship to other professional employees including developing succession planning

ABOUT TE CONNECTIVITY
TE Connectivity is a global industrial technology leader creating a safer, sustainable, productive and connected future. Our broad range of connectivity and sensor solutions, proven in the harshest environments, enable advancements in transportation, industrial applications, medical technology, energy, data communications and the home. With more than 85,000 employees, including more than 7,500 engineers, working alongside customers in approximately 140 countries, TE ensures that EVERY CONNECTION COUNTS.
